Eminem New Album 2013 Release Date Still Secret, But Slim Shady Popping Up All Over; On Skylar Grey and Big Sean's New Records

Eminem's new album 2013 release date is still being kept under wraps, but Slim Shady is casting a big shadow on new releases. Eminem did a duo with the rapper Big Sean on his upcoming "Hall of Fame" album that will hit shelves on Aug. 27. Eminem also pulled an assist on the first solo album for pop singer Skylar Grey, who co-wrote Eminem’s song “Love the Way You Lie.” Eminem also appears in the documentrary “How to Make Money Selling Drugs” where he talks candidly about how prescription pills almost killed pulled the shades down forever.

Eminem’s new album 2013 release date isn’t until the fall, his manager said. But Eminem is keeping himself busy. Besides planning a mini-tour of Europe he collaborated on the new Big Sean record. Big Sean, who is from the same neighborhood as Slim Shady said he enjoyed working on the record with Eminem.

Big Sean said "There's gonna be a Big Sean-Eminem song. I don't know if it's gonna be on my album, it might be for something that we got planned later on. He's a true OG. I don't know if there's any misconceptions about Eminem, but that dude's real polite, real nice. I ended up playing my whole album, front-to-back, straight through, and he said, 'I haven't been this impressed in so long with someone's album, I knew you could rap,' he was like, 'you're really going to do something big with this.' So that was just an honor, coming from the D, that was the person that showed us that it was real, showed us you can be the biggest in the world from where we from.”

Skylar Grey co-wrote Eminem's Grammy-nominated smash hit single "Love the Way You Lie." The song was about an abusive relationship. It’s had over 575 million YouTube views. Skyler Grey got five Grammy nominations and collaborated with such huge stars as Sean "Diddy" Combs, will.i.am and Lupe Fiasco. Eminem was the executive producer of her first solo album "Don't Look Down," which came out last week on Interscope Records. She come a long way since singing about sweets and treats as a kid.

Skylar Grey said "I was writing about green popsicles, and I was 3 years old. I played with my mom and it was very sweet and I loved being on the stage, performing and making music. That's when I knew I would make a career out of it." A psychic changed her life, "She told me there's going to be an opportunity to go to L.A., and you should definitely go. I couldn't afford rent or food. I couldn't afford the laundromat, so I washed my clothes in the bathtub. I tried getting a couple of jobs. I got a job editing porn because it was good money, but it got to be really unhealthy as you can imagine."

After a trip to New York, she shopped around the song “Love the Way You Lie.” Da Kid loved the hook and sent it to Eminem who put it on “Recovery" album which came out in June 2010, The song got nominated for two Grammys, including song of the year. Rihanna sang it, Eminem rapped it. Grey appeared at Lollapalooza as part of Eminem's headlining set.

Grey said "I hit a point halfway through my album where making the music wasn't fun anymore. Luckily, I talked with (Interscope co-founder and chairman) Jimmy Iovine, and he agreed I should slow down and take my time.... At this point, I really felt like I needed a fresh set of ears — this is when Eminem came on board to executive produce the album. He had a lot of good feedback and helped me to believe in myself again."
